Selected by Jean Pierre Vibert before 1837, this Damascena rose has pink blooms with paler edges, flat, full (40 petals), 8 cm in diameter and with an intense fragrance. Recommended by David Austin it had also achieved a Garden of Merit Award by the RHS (Royal Horticultural Society); grows strong, vigorous and well-branched to a height of 150 cm and a width of 100-120 cm but is also suitable to be pot-grown. A once-blooming but generous variety.
